XHP

Software skärmdump:
XHP
Mjukvaruinformation:
Version: 2.2.2 Uppdaterad
Ladda upp dagen: 1 Oct 15
Utvecklare: Facebook
Licens: Gratis
Popularitet: 99

Rating: 3.5/5 (Total Votes: 2)

Detta förvandlar i princip PHP i en mall motor, genom att ge den möjlighet att återanvända data som vill.
XHP fungerar genom att analysera och tolka innehåll hittades inuti klammerparentes {} som en fullständig PHP-uttryck, som vanligtvis används endast för variabler.
Genom att förbättra denna standard syntax utvecklaren kan nu återanvända kod mycket enklare, vilket gör XHP idealisk för kodning användargränssnitt och templated layouter.
Bruksanvisningar medföljer XHP README fil

Vad är nytt i den här versionen.

  • Konvertera till Hack. Den 1.x utgåveserien stöds fortfarande för användare av PHP5
  • Lade AwaitableXHP; Detta gör att du kan bygga effektiva XHP komponenter där data hämtar krav är en detalj genomförandet i stället för en del av API de presenterar
  • Attribut tvång är nu mycket striktare, och höjer en E_DEPRECATED. I en framtida utgåva kommer Hack typechecker behandla alla tvång att vara ett misstag, och XHP-Lib kommer att kasta ett undantag.
  • Lade XHPUnsafeRenderable och XHPAlwaysValidChild gränssnitt, vilket gör det enklare att inkludera uppmärkning från andra källor i en XHP träd. Se MIGRATING.md för mer information
  • Dela ut getID (), addClass (), transferAttributes () och vänner från: x: html-elementet till en ny XHPHelpers drag, som implementerar nya HasXHPHelpers gränssnittet
  • Lägg till ny XHPRoot gränssnittet genomförs av: x: primitiv och: x: sammansättnings element. Detta är retur typ av render ()
  • Removed Infordringsbar attributtyp, eftersom det inte stöds av Hack
  • Funktioner som behandlas med arrayer (t.ex. getAttributes ()) använder nu Vector karta, eller Set
  • Inkom reflektion; ReflectionXHPClass är den viktigaste inkörsporten

Vad är nytt i version 2.2.0:

  • Konvertera till Hack. Den 1.x utgåveserien stöds fortfarande för användare av PHP5
  • Lade AwaitableXHP; Detta gör att du kan bygga effektiva XHP komponenter där data hämtar krav är en detalj genomförandet i stället för en del av API de presenterar
  • Attribut tvång är nu mycket striktare, och höjer en E_DEPRECATED. I en framtida utgåva kommer Hack typechecker behandla alla tvång att vara ett misstag, och XHP-Lib kommer att kasta ett undantag.
  • Lade XHPUnsafeRenderable och XHPAlwaysValidChild gränssnitt, vilket gör det enklare att inkludera uppmärkning från andra källor i en XHP träd. Se MIGRATING.md för mer information
  • Dela ut getID (), addClass (), transferAttributes () och vänner från: x: html-elementet till en ny XHPHelpers drag, som implementerar nya HasXHPHelpers gränssnittet
  • Lägg till ny XHPRoot gränssnittet genomförs av: x: primitiv och: x: sammansättnings element. Detta är retur typ av render ()
  • Removed Infordringsbar attributtyp, eftersom det inte stöds av Hack
  • Funktioner som behandlas med arrayer (t.ex. getAttributes ()) använder nu Vector karta, eller Set
  • Inkom reflektion; ReflectionXHPClass är den viktigaste inkörsporten

Vad är nytt i version 2.1.0:

  • Konvertera till Hack. Den 1.x utgåveserien stöds fortfarande för användare av PHP5
  • Lade AwaitableXHP; Detta gör att du kan bygga effektiva XHP komponenter där data hämtar krav är en detalj genomförandet i stället för en del av API de presenterar
  • Attribut tvång är nu mycket striktare, och höjer en E_DEPRECATED. I en framtida utgåva kommer Hack typechecker behandla alla tvång att vara ett misstag, och XHP-Lib kommer att kasta ett undantag.
  • Lade XHPUnsafeRenderable och XHPAlwaysValidChild gränssnitt, vilket gör det enklare att inkludera uppmärkning från andra källor i en XHP träd. Se MIGRATING.md för mer information
  • Dela ut getID (), addClass (), transferAttributes () och vänner från: x: html-elementet till en ny XHPHelpers drag, som implementerar nya HasXHPHelpers gränssnittet
  • Lägg till ny XHPRoot gränssnittet genomförs av: x: primitiv och: x: sammansättnings element. Detta är retur typ av render ()
  • Removed Infordringsbar attributtyp, eftersom det inte stöds av Hack
  • Funktioner som behandlas med arrayer (t.ex. getAttributes ()) använder nu Vector karta, eller Set
  • Inkom reflektion; ReflectionXHPClass är den viktigaste inkörsporten

Vad är nytt i version 2.0.0:

  • Konvertera till Hack. Den 1.x utgåveserien stöds fortfarande för användare av PHP5
  • Lade AwaitableXHP; Detta gör att du kan bygga effektiva XHP komponenter där data hämtar krav är en detalj genomförandet i stället för en del av API de presenterar
  • Attribut tvång är nu mycket striktare, och höjer en E_DEPRECATED. I en framtida utgåva kommer Hack typechecker behandla alla tvång att vara ett misstag, och XHP-Lib kommer att kasta ett undantag.
  • Lade XHPUnsafeRenderable och XHPAlwaysValidChild gränssnitt, vilket gör det enklare att inkludera uppmärkning från andra källor i en XHP träd. Se MIGRATING.md för mer information
  • Dela ut getID (), addClass (), transferAttributes () och vänner från: x: html-elementet till en ny XHPHelpers drag, som implementerar nya HasXHPHelpers gränssnittet
  • Lägg till ny XHPRoot gränssnittet genomförs av: x: primitiv och: x: sammansättnings element. Detta är retur typ av render ()
  • Removed Infordringsbar attributtyp, eftersom det inte stöds av Hack
  • Funktioner som behandlas med arrayer (t.ex. getAttributes ()) använder nu Vector karta, eller Set
  • Inkom reflektion; ReflectionXHPClass är den viktigaste inkörsporten

Vad är nytt i version 1.6.0:

  • Eftersom detta förvar inte längre innehåller en PHP5 förlängning, Zend och PHP-licenser är inte lämpliga. Relicensed som BSD
  • Du kan nu lägga till XHP till kompositör baserad PHP-projektet (facebook / xhp-lib)
  • Andra uppmärkning kan nu bäddas in XHP via XHPUnsafeRenderable och XHPAlwaysValidChild gränssnitt - se MIGRATING.md för mer information
  • Tillhandahålla toString () liksom __toString (). De är identiska, men kalla toString () kommer att ge dig mycket trevligare bakåtspårningar
  • Validering var alltför strikt. Avslappnad.
  • Lade HTML villkorliga kommentarer
  • Förbättrat stöd för Hack vektorer, Set, och kartlägger
  • Support kapslade array specifikationer - t.ex. array & # x3c; array & # x3c, string, int & # x3e; & # x3e;
  • Enstaka citat är nu tillåtna i HTML-attribut utan att rymt

Vad är nytt i version 1.4.

  • Stöd för PHP 5.5
  • Uppgraderingar till HTML5 specifikationer.
  • Buggfixar.

Liknande mjukvara

XPath.js
XPath.js

5 Jun 15

LibXML
LibXML

28 Feb 15

Annan programvara för utvecklare Facebook

Kommentarer till XHP

Kommentarer hittades inte
Kommentar
Slå på bilder!